在Unix环境下,H5服务端的高并发优化需要从多个层面入手。操作系统本身的配置对性能有直接影响,例如调整文件描述符限制、内核参数优化等。
使用高效的网络框架是关键,比如选择Nginx作为反向代理,能够有效处理大量并发连接。同时,后端服务可采用Node.js或Go语言,这些语言在处理高并发场景时表现出色。
数据库优化同样重要,合理使用缓存机制如Redis可以显著降低数据库压力。•对SQL查询进行优化,避免全表扫描,能提升整体响应速度。
负载均衡技术也能帮助分散流量,避免单点故障。通过Keepalived或HAProxy实现多节点负载,提高系统的可用性和扩展性。
日志和监控工具的使用不可忽视,利用Prometheus和Grafana实时监控系统状态,及时发现瓶颈并进行调整。

AI辅助生成图,仅供参考
最终,代码层面的优化也不能忽略,减少阻塞操作,合理使用异步和非阻塞IO,确保每个请求都能快速完成。